Structured_description | Concise_description | F25B4.2 encodes a protein with similarity to the Pellino family of E3 ubiquitin ligases that function in regulation of Toll signaling; loss of F25B4.2 activity via RNAi results in embryonic arrest; an F25B4.2::mCherry promoter fusion is expressed in ciliated neurons, including the ASK, ADL, ASI, ASH, ASJ, PHA and PHB neurons, and in muscle cells during larval development; F25B4.2 expression in ciliated neurons is dependent upon the DAF-19 regulatory factor X (RFX) transcription factor; the product of F25B4.2 has been shown to physically interact with the MEX-3 KH domain protein. | Paper_evidence | WBPaper00005160 | |||||

Automated_description | Predicted to enable ubiquitin protein ligase activity. Predicted to be involved in protein polyubiquitination. Expressed in chemosensory neurons; ciliated neurons; and head. Human ortholog(s) of this gene implicated in colorectal cancer. Is an ortholog of human PELI2 (pellino E3 ubiquitin protein ligase family member 2) and PELI3 (pellino E3 ubiquitin protein ligase family member 3). | Paper_evidence | WBPaper00065943 | ||||||
